UIA Federations Canada is a national Jewish fundraising organization and community planning body which was established in June 1998, as a result of the re-organization of the United Israel Appeal of Canada Inc., and the Council of Jewish Federations of Canada. Having fundraising and community development at the core of its objectives, UIAFC recognizes its responsibility to support and strengthen Jewish communities across Canada. With responsibility both to Canada and Israel, UIAFC looks to raise funds from communities both for local and overseas needs. more

UIAFC in Israel
Based in Jerusalem, the UIAFC office plays an instrumental role in consistently communicating critical Campaign needs to Canadian communities regarding social welfare and humanitarian projects and programs. In Israel, the office coordinates missions, manages capitol projects and programs, represents Canada to JAFI and KH. The activities of UIAFC in Israel are supervised by the Israel Residents Committee consisting of volunteers of Canadian origin now living in Israel.
